The untitled DreamWorks’ Wikileaks film has finally got a tentative title and according to The Film Stage it’s The Man Who Sold The World. The film enters production this January, and Variety is now reporting that Dan Stevens has joined the cast. The film stars Benedict Cumberbatch, Daniel Bruhl and Alicia Vikander. The Man Who Sold The World follows the story of “the Wikileaks founder who launched the whistleblowing site in 2006 and began leaking embarrassing diplomatic cables and other state secrets.”
